Hey everybody. Tldr: I'm looking for advice on some potential initial steps into the industry

Background: I will graduate with a BAS in Cybersecurity Technology in July 2025. I am currently active duty Air Force in a non-tech job (Munitions). I'm an NCO, which is probably the equivalent of a "middle manager" type position so i do have some decent experience with management and team work. I do possess a clearance and have earned my sec+. While I admittedly do not have any substantial cyber experience, I have utilized my certification to get the DoD 8140 IAT II to get elevated network access which I use to (try) keep my units machines compliant and to take somewhat of a "help desk" role as an additional duty. I also try to do some CTF's in my free time and I am working on joining my schools cyber club.

I think I'm really interested in landing in an analyst or incident response type position.

I know I'll have a hard time getting my foot in the door which is why I'm looking for advice/opinions/options. I do get the benefit of being able to take an internship while maintaining military pay and benefits for up to 6 months before I separate from service (I separate Jan 2026). This is the best option I see for myself since it gets me some OJT while still paying my bills. The difficult part is I still need to qualify for the internship.

In the end, I will need to land a spot earning at least 80k to match my current standard of living. Is this feasible for an entry spot?

I just want to say that the GBU-38 modeling is maybe the most frustrating part of the F16 for me. The GBU-38 model we have is NOT valid. You could never use a mechanical fuse with the electric fuse in the tail. The initiators are incompatible.
